This is how Apple mounts the protective films for the iPhone

Last night I told you that Apple has authorized the installation of protective films for iPhone screens in Apple Stores his, those from Cupertino making this decision after years in which they refused to do such procedures in stores for a varied range of reasons.

Collaborating with those from Belkin, Apple has trained its employees in almost all Apple Stores on the planet on how to mount a foil on an iPhone terminal as correctly as possible in a store, and in the video clip below you can see how accomplish everything.

The video clip was recorded in a Apple Store from Japan, the employee Apple Lossless Audio CODEC (ALAC), using a device of Belkin to place the film as best as possible on the front panel of the iPhone, in order that the functionality of the terminal is not affected along with the clarity of the screen.

Belkin TrueClear Pro it is called the device that allows mounting foil on the iPhone screen, the cost of a foil varying between 19 dollars and 37 dollars in Japan, the installation being free, as is also the case with services that sell foils for iPhones.

In Europe, the procedure should be carried out in a similar way, but the prices for the foils will be different and in Romania, for now, I don't think there is a system of this kind.
